Transaction 57abf4ee4cc4c6b67bf58156657066f8b91ea2f986f0a89adfe64b079b2c8d66

2 Input
1 Outputs
  • 57abf4ee4cc4c6b67bf58156657066f8b91ea2f986f0a89adfe64b079b2c8d66:0
  • value  27820000
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d